Driver of the Global Polyurethane Composites Market
The Global Polyurethane Composites market is significantly driven by the rising demand for lightweight materials, especially in the transportation and aviation industries. The emphasis on lighter components yields both functional and environmental advantages, particularly within the automotive sector, where reduced vehicle weight leads to enhanced fuel efficiency and lower greenhouse gas emissions. This not only decreases operational costs for consumers but also improves vehicle handling and acceleration. In aviation, lightweight polyurethane composites are essential for improving fuel efficiency, extending flight ranges, and accommodating greater payloads. The combined pressures of regulatory standards and performance enhancements are positioning polyurethane composites as a vital material across various industrial applications, particularly as the automotive industry increasingly shifts towards fuel-efficient and electric vehicles.
Restraints in the Global Polyurethane Composites Market
The Global Polyurethane Composites market faces significant restraints primarily due to the reliance on isocyanates and polyols, which are predominantly sourced from crude oil. This dependence subjects their prices to fluctuations resulting from global energy market dynamics, including supply chain disruptions, geopolitical tensions, and imbalances in crude oil production. Such volatility can adversely affect producers by complicating cost forecasting and reducing price competitiveness. Consequently, the cost-effectiveness of polyurethane composites might suffer when compared to more stable alternatives. This economic and technological unpredictability serves as a barrier to the broader adoption of polyurethane composites in cost-sensitive applications, hindering overall market growth.
Market Trends of the Global Polyurethane Composites Market
The Global Polyurethane Composites market is witnessing a significant trend towards sustainability, particularly through the adoption of bio-based polyurethane composites. This shift is largely driven by the pressing need to reduce reliance on fossil fuels and adhere to environmental regulations. Industries are increasingly leveraging renewable resources like vegetable oils, starch, and cellulose to create polyurethane resins and reinforcing fibers, which not only diminishes carbon footprints but also enhances biodegradability and minimizes VOC emissions. Ongoing research aims to elevate the performance of these bio-based composites, positioning them as viable alternatives to traditional materials, particularly in sectors such as automotive, construction, and consumer products, thereby aligning with global sustainability goals and the transition towards a circular economy.
